AI-generated software often carries hidden performance issues that don't appear until real users and traffic hit the system. Our experts identify bottlenecks across your stack and fix issues like N+1 database queries, inefficient API responses, tight coupling, unindexed lookups, memory leaks, and oversized frontend bundles.

No, the goal of our vibe coding cleanup specialist is to stabilise and improve the codebase without disrupting any core functionality. The cleanup work is generally done using controlled refactoring, feature branches, automated testing, and staged validation to reduce regression risk.
